Airlines Use Hedging to Mitigate Fuel Price Risks

Airlines Use Hedging to Mitigate Fuel Price Risks

Airline fuel hedging is a crucial strategy for managing oil price volatility and stabilizing profits. Airlines utilize financial instruments like futures, options, and swaps to lock in fuel costs and mitigate risk. Mitchell Plateau Airport Key to Kimberley Regions Air Access

Mitchell Plateau Airport Key to Kimberley Regions Air Access

Mitchell Plateau Airport (MIH/YMIP) is a crucial aviation hub in the Kimberley region of Western Australia, connecting remote communities to the outside world. Its unique geographical location primarily serves local residents and the tourism industry. The airport provides basic facilities and services. Future upgrades and expansions are anticipated as the Kimberley region's tourism sector continues to develop. The airport plays a vital role in supporting the region's connectivity and economic growth, particularly for those living in isolated areas.
